Components of Effective Coaching
Assess knowledge Show and explain how you want the task
or procedure done Ask the employee to perform the task –
ask for understanding before the assignment
Evaluate the employee’s performance and provide feedback

Learning styles
Visual, auditory, or spatial? Talk to think, or think before talk? Focused on the task, or like interruptions? Ask questions first, or plunge right in? “Big picture”, or detail-oriented? Quick or deliberate?
Coaching Good Work
When you see it, say it! Be specific
Coaching Poor Work
Don’t do it in public! Make it positive Let the learner choose their own path Be caring Ask questions Be gentle, but direct You’ve got to do it!
Coaching Poor Habits
Make it private Make it positive Be gentle, but direct Be aware of defensive side tracks
The 2 Minute Challenge
State what was observed Wait for a response Remind them of the goal Ask for a specific solution Agree together
